Today I’ll show you how to use one of the most powerful Photoshop tools: the pen tool. After decided to start this series of tutorials, I had no doubt about the first topic to face. The pen tool is a fundamental tool. Even if it is one of the most painful things to learn, but once learned you will ask yourself how could you have made without. Getting started with the pen tool Create a new document in Photoshop with a white background. Switch your foreground color to a nice blue. Grab the pen tool by selecting it from the tool bar on the left and start randomly clicking over the canvas. This is one of the basic functions of the pen tool. You can use it to create shapes.
